Mesothelioma Claim - How to File a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ma lawsuit can assist victims and their families get compensation from the companies responsible for asbestos exposure. This compensation can cover medical costs and other expenses that are not covered by insurance.

An experienced lawyer can help victims to understand their options regarding compensation. This can include trust funds, asbestos suits and other financial aid sources, including VA benefits Workers' compensation, VA benefits.

VA Benefits

Veterans suffering from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ses, may be eligible for financial compensation for medical costs. They may also be eligible for healthcare at VA hospitals. In some instances, a VA doctor may refer the patient to a civilian mesothelioma specialist. This option allows patients to avoid travelling far from home and save money on travel expenses.

Compensation programs for veterans suffering from mesothelioma are Dependency and Indemnity Compensation (DIC) and Survivors Pension. Workers' Compensation

Generally, workers' compensation pays medical expenses and lost wages for employees who is injured or falls ill on the job. In certain states, it also covers funeral expenses and death benefits. Workers compensation insurance is a state-mandated program. Therefore, rules and benefits are different widely by state.

Workers' compensation benefits provide a variety of treatments, like chemotherapy and surgical procedures. It may also cover the patient's ongoing medication. Workers' compensation may also cover a patient's travel costs to and from a treatment facility. Contact your employer to confirm if you are covered. Treatment Grants

Treatment for mesothelioma can be expensive, particularly if a patient is receiving multiple forms of treatment. Travel expenses, meals and accommodation for family members who are attending treatment sessions, as well as housing in the home to accommodate medical equipment or assistive treatment can increase the financial burden. Many organizations offer mesothelioma cancer grants to help patients with the costs associated with these expenses.
